The Lorca will perform a free review of the condition of the tires of their vehicles (16/07/2010)

This is an initiative launched from the city council in coordination with the Ministry of Universities, Business and Research with the aim of raising awareness among citizens about the need to check their vehicles to improve road safety

The Councillor for Citizen Security of the City of Lorca, Belén Pérez, reported that on Monday from 9 o'clock in the morning and half will develop in the Fairgrounds Huerto de la Rueda a day of awareness on road safety, which will feature a car tire.

Perez noted that this is an activity carried out in coordination with the Ministry of Universities, Business and Research, through the Directorate General of Industry, Energy and Mines, which proposes that the Public Service Dealers ITV commissioning a campaign of public awareness on road safety, related to the maintenance of their vehicles.

All this following a study by the University of Murcia which is exposed the link between accidents with victims and condition, and therefore the involvement of a poor condition of the tires of vehicles .

In this report, the University of Murcia shows that 60% of injury accidents are caused by mechanical failure due to condition of the tires.

Sources of the event organizers have noted that during the period under study we have analyzed the defects found in the periodic inspection of 878,811 cars found that 22% of all serious defects analyzed for the chapter of tires while this percentage rises to 60% in the case of very serious defects at risk of imminent crash.

In view of the results and apply various scientific methods to estimate the number of casualties avoided through the detection of these defects in the periodic inspection shows that they have prevented about 87 accidents per year driven by having a defect in the tires only in the Autonomous Region of Murcia.

The study was conducted by professors from the engineering machinery and other mechanical and thermal Murcia University in collaboration with the Directorate General of Industry, Energy and Mines of the Autonomous Community of Murcia and several ITV companies Region of Murcia.
